引言
在网络技术中,VRRP(Virtual Router Redundancy Protocol,虚拟路由冗余协议)和MSTP(Multiple Spanning Tree Protocol,多重 spanning tree 协议)是两种重要的网络协议。它们分别解决了网络冗余和环路避免的问题。本文将深入探讨VRRP与MSTP的原理、应用场景以及如何将它们结合使用,以达到提升网络稳定性和性能的目的。
VRRP:虚拟路由冗余协议
VRRP简介
VRRP是一种网络协议,它允许一组路由器共同工作,提供冗余的虚拟路由器功能。当一个主路由器出现故障时,备用路由器可以立即接管,确保网络服务的连续性。
VRRP工作原理
VRRP通过选举一个虚拟路由器作为主路由器,其他路由器作为备份路由器。主路由器负责处理所有数据包转发,而备份路由器则在主路由器失效时接管其功能。
VRRP应用场景
- 提高网络可靠性:通过冗余路由器实现故障转移,避免单点故障。
- 提高网络性能:负载均衡,分散流量,提高网络处理能力。
MSTP:多重 spanning tree 协议
MSTP简介
MSTP是一种网络协议,它允许在环网中部署多个 spanning tree,从而避免环路同时存在,提高网络稳定性和性能。
MSTP工作原理
MSTP通过创建多个独立的 spanning tree,每个 spanning tree 负责不同的流量转发。这样,即使某些链路或设备出现故障,网络也能保持稳定运行。
MSTP应用场景
- 避免环路:防止环路导致网络性能下降或瘫痪。
- 提高网络性能:通过多路径转发,实现负载均衡。
VRRP与MSTP双剑合璧
结合原理
将VRRP与MSTP结合使用,可以在网络中实现以下效果:
- 通过VRRP实现冗余路由器,提高网络可靠性。
- 通过MSTP避免环路,提高网络稳定性。
- VRRP主路由器与MSTP spanning tree的根节点对应,确保主路由器在故障时能够快速接管。
应用场景
- 数据中心网络:通过VRRP与MSTP的结合,实现高可用、高性能的网络环境。
- 大型企业网络:确保关键业务网络的稳定运行。
案例分析
以下是一个结合VRRP与MSTP的实际案例:
假设有一个企业网络,其中包含两台核心交换机A和B,以及多台接入交换机。通过VRRP,将交换机A设置为虚拟路由器,交换机B作为备份路由器。同时,在交换机A和B之间部署MSTP,实现网络环路避免。
- 当交换机A出现故障时,交换机B通过VRRP接管虚拟路由器功能,确保网络服务的连续性。
- 同时,MSTP确保交换机A和B之间的连接不会形成环路,保证网络稳定运行。
总结
VRRP与MSTP双剑合璧,可以在网络中实现高可用、高性能的目标。通过深入了解这两种协议的原理和应用场景,我们可以更好地规划和部署网络,提升网络稳定性和性能。